mysql社区版8.0.23安装教程,mysql社区版使用时间

欧气 5 0

《MySQL社区版8.0.23的安装与使用时间相关探讨》

一、MySQL社区版8.0.23安装教程

1、准备工作

- 系统要求:MySQL 8.0.23可以安装在多种操作系统上,如Windows、Linux、macOS等,在安装之前,确保你的系统满足最低要求,在Windows系统上,需要Windows 10或更高版本(对于64位系统)。

- 下载安装包:访问MySQL官方网站(https://dev.mysql.com/downloads/mysql/),在下载页面中找到MySQL Community Server 8.0.23版本的安装包,根据你的操作系统类型(32位或64位)进行下载。

mysql社区版8.0.23安装教程,mysql社区版使用时间

图片来源于网络,如有侵权联系删除

2、在Windows系统上的安装

- 运行安装程序:找到下载好的安装程序(.msi文件),双击运行,在安装向导的初始界面,选择“Custom(自定义)”安装类型,这样可以对安装选项进行更多的控制。

- 选择安装组件:在组件选择页面,可以根据需求选择安装MySQL Server、MySQL Workbench(一个方便的数据库管理工具)等组件,对于基本的数据库使用,MySQL Server是必须安装的。

- 配置安装路径:可以修改MySQL的安装路径到你想要的位置,默认路径一般是在“C:\Program Files\MySQL\MySQL Server 8.0.23”,建议将其安装在一个非系统盘的分区,以避免系统重装等情况对数据库文件造成影响。

- 配置服务器类型和网络选项:在这一步,可以选择MySQL服务器类型,如“Development Machine(开发机器)”,这适用于本地开发环境,对资源占用相对较少,对于网络选项,默认的端口是3306,如果需要更改,可以在这里进行设置,不过,在大多数情况下,保持默认端口即可。

- 设置根用户密码:这是非常重要的一步,为MySQL的根用户(root)设置一个安全的密码,密码应该包含字母、数字和特殊字符的组合,以提高安全性。

- 完成安装:完成上述配置后,点击“Install(安装)”按钮开始安装过程,安装完成后,可以选择是否启动MySQL服务。

3、在Linux系统上的安装(以Ubuntu为例)

mysql社区版8.0.23安装教程,mysql社区版使用时间

图片来源于网络,如有侵权联系删除

- 更新系统:在安装MySQL之前,先打开终端,运行命令“sudo apt - get update”和“sudo apt - get upgrade”来更新系统的软件包列表和已安装的软件包。

- 安装MySQL:在终端中运行命令“sudo apt - get install mysql - server - 8.0.23”,系统会自动下载并安装MySQL 8.0.23及其相关的依赖项。

- 安全配置:安装完成后,运行命令“sudo mysql_secure_installation”,这一命令可以帮助你进行一些安全设置,如设置根用户密码(如果在安装过程中没有设置)、删除匿名用户、禁止远程根用户登录等。

4、在macOS系统上的安装

- 下载安装包:从MySQL官方网站下载适用于macOS的MySQL Community Server 8.0.23安装包(.dmg文件)。

- 安装过程:打开下载好的.dmg文件,将MySQL图标拖移到“Applications(应用程序)”文件夹中,打开终端,进入到MySQL的安装目录(一般在“/usr/local/mysql”),运行初始化脚本“sudo bin/mysql_install_db --user = mysql”。

- 启动MySQL服务:在终端中运行命令“sudo launchctl load - w /Library/LaunchDaemons/com.mysql.mysql.plist”来启动MySQL服务,设置根用户密码等安全配置可以参考Linux系统中的“mysql_secure_installation”类似的操作。

二、MySQL社区版使用时间相关探讨

mysql社区版8.0.23安装教程,mysql社区版使用时间

图片来源于网络,如有侵权联系删除

1、免费使用与限制

- MySQL社区版是开源且免费使用的,对于个人开发者、小型企业和创业公司来说,这是一个非常有吸引力的选择,它也有一些限制,它可能没有企业版那样完善的技术支持服务,在使用时间方面,没有明确的使用期限限制,只要你遵守开源协议(如GPL协议),就可以持续使用。

2、项目生命周期中的使用

- 在项目的开发阶段,MySQL社区版可以作为后端数据库的理想选择,开发人员可以快速搭建数据库环境,进行数据模型的设计、数据存储和查询操作的开发,由于其开源的特性,开发团队可以根据项目需求对MySQL进行定制化开发,对于一个持续开发时间可能长达数年的大型项目,MySQL社区版可以一直被使用,从项目的初始架构搭建到后续的功能扩展和优化。

- 在项目的部署阶段,如果是内部使用或者符合开源协议的对外部署,MySQL社区版也能够很好地胜任,不过,如果项目后期发展成为大型的商业应用,可能需要考虑企业版的MySQL以获得更高级别的技术支持、性能优化和安全保障等服务,但这并不影响在前期和中期较长时间内对社区版的使用。

3、社区版的更新与持续使用

- MySQL社区版会不断更新版本,如从8.0.23到后续的版本,用户可以根据自己的需求和时间安排来决定是否进行版本更新,新的版本会修复旧版本的漏洞、提高性能和增加新的功能,如果在项目使用MySQL社区版的过程中,有对新功能的需求或者受到安全漏洞的影响,就需要考虑及时更新版本,但更新也需要谨慎进行,因为可能会对现有项目的数据库结构和应用程序与数据库的交互产生影响,不过,只要遵循正确的更新流程,就可以在不影响项目正常运行的情况下持续使用MySQL社区版,并随着版本的更新不断提升数据库的性能和安全性,从而满足项目长期发展的需求。

标签: #mysql #社区版 #8.0.23 #安装教程

  • 评论列表

留言评论